What we confirm before quoting

  • Required FAD/airflow at the actual working pressure
  • Current and future simultaneous air demand
  • Daily operating hours and load profile
  • Electrical supply, ventilation and plant-room access
  • Receiver, dryer, filtration and condensate requirements

Practical answers

Screw compressor selection FAQs

These answers cover common planning questions. Final recommendations are confirmed from the machine data and site conditions.

Why is motor kW not enough to select a screw compressor?

Compressors with the same motor power can deliver different airflow at different pressures. Selection should use the manufacturer’s FAD at the required working pressure.

When does a VSD compressor make sense?

VSD is most useful where air demand varies meaningfully. A stable base load may be better served by fixed speed, or by a correctly sequenced combination of machines.

What should be included in a complete compressor package?

A complete system may include the compressor, air receiver, refrigerated dryer, filtration, condensate management, electrical coordination, ventilation and distribution piping.

How much receiver capacity is required?

Receiver sizing depends on compressor control, demand peaks, acceptable pressure variation and the application. It should be calculated rather than chosen only from motor size.

What information is required before ordering?

Confirm FAD, working pressure, power supply, ambient conditions, operating hours, air-quality requirement, installation access and future demand.

How often must a screw compressor be serviced?

Intervals depend on the manufacturer, operating hours and site conditions. Dust, heat and heavy duty can justify closer inspection even before the scheduled service hours are reached.
